The Importance of Delayed Gratification and Long-Term Thinking in Real Estate
Successful real estate investors emphasize the significance of delayed gratification and long-term planning. They stress the need to make decisions now that may not yield immediate benefits but could have substantial returns in the future. Instant gratification often leads to short-sighted choices that are not in one's best interest in the long run. True entrepreneurs understand that value doesn't always equate to money and are proficient in recognizing value even when it's not immediately monetarily apparent. Their focus lies in understanding the potential, future worth, and steps required to actualize that value into monetary gains.
